XIII Agni

1. Agni is wakened by the people's fuel to meet the Dawn who cometh like a milch-cow.

Like young trees shooting up on high their branches, his flames mounting to the vault of heaven.

2. For the Gods' worship hath the priest been wakened: kind Agni hath arisen erect at morning.

Kindled, his radiant might is made apparent, and the great God hath been set free from darkness.

3. When he hath roused the line of his attendants, with the bright milk bright Agni is anointed.

Then is prepared the effectual oblation, which spread in front, with tongues, erect, he drinketh,
